ITEM 5.02 DEPARTURE OF DIRECTORS OR PRINCIPAL OFFICERS; ELECTION OF DIRECTORS; APPOINTMENT OF PRINCIPAL OFFICERS
(c) (1) On November 14, 2006, New Century Bancorp, Inc. (the “Registrant”) announced that it had appointed William L. Hedgepeth, II to serve as Executive Vice President and Chief Operating Officer of its wholly owned subsidiary, New Century Bank. The Registrant’s press release announcing Mr. Hedgepeth’s appointment as Executive Vice President and Chief Operating Officer of New Century Bank is filed as Exhibit 99.1 to this report and incorporated by reference into this Item 5.02.
(2) Mr. Hedgepeth (44) has served as President and Chief Executive Officer of New Century Bank South, the Registrant’s other wholly-owned bank subsidiary, since 2004 and will continue to serve in such capacities going forward. Mr. Hedgepeth also currently serves as an Executive Vice President of the Registrant. Mr. Hedgepeth served as Senior Vice President and Area Executive for Fayetteville, North Carolina for First South Bank from 2001 to 2004 and, prior to that, as City Executive for Fayetteville, North Carolina for Triangle Bank from 1997 to 2001.

ITEM 8.01 OTHER EVENTS
On November 15, 2006, the Registrant announced that on November 14, 2006, its Board of Directors declared a 6-for-5 stock split to be effected in the form of a 20% stock dividend. The dividend is payable on December 12, 2006 to shareholders of record as of November 28, 2006. Shareholders will receive cash in lieu of fractional shares.
